#8350b8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8350b8 is composed of 51.4% red, 31.4%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.8% cyan, 56.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 269.4 degrees, a saturation of 42.3% and a lightness of 51.8%. #8350b8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a0ff with #070071.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

● #8350b8 color description : Moderate violet.
#8350b8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8350b8 has RGB values of R:131, G:80, B:184 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 8605880.
